From 01c71a69673192a484788a584abe51512e310b3a Mon Sep 17 00:00:00 2001 From: =?utf8?q?Rapha=C3=ABl=20Barrois?= Date: Sun, 28 Sep 2014 13:20:21 +0200 Subject: [PATCH] Require 'groupmember' perms for group NL pages. Subscribers to a group newsletter needs to be member of the group. --- modules/xnetnl.php |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/modules/xnetnl.php b/modules/xnetnl.php index 61764e0..f26b083 100644 --- a/modules/xnetnl.php +++ b/modules/xnetnl.php @@ -26,9 +26,9 @@ class XnetNlModule extends NewsletterModule function handlers() { return array( - '%grp/nl' => $this->make_hook('nl', AUTH_PASSWD, 'groups'), - '%grp/nl/show' => $this->make_hook('nl_show', AUTH_PASSWD, 'groups'), - '%grp/nl/search' => $this->make_hook('nl_search', AUTH_PASSWD, 'groups'), + '%grp/nl' => $this->make_hook('nl', AUTH_PASSWD, 'groupmember'), + '%grp/nl/show' => $this->make_hook('nl_show', AUTH_PASSWD, 'groupmember'), + '%grp/nl/search' => $this->make_hook('nl_search', AUTH_PASSWD, 'groupmember'), '%grp/admin/nl' => $this->make_hook('admin_nl', AUTH_PASSWD, 'groupadmin'), '%grp/admin/nl/sync' => $this->make_hook('admin_nl_sync', AUTH_PASSWD, 'groupadmin'), '%grp/admin/nl/enable' => $this->make_hook('admin_nl_enable', AUTH_PASSWD, 'groupadmin'), -- 2.1.4